Porto to Florence by bus

Long-distance coaches connect Porto and Florence with a typical journey of 23h 37m. Buses are usually the slowest mode for this corridor but consistently the cheapest.

Operators include FlixBus, BlaBlaCar Bus.

Fares start from around €50 when booked in advance, rising to €136 for last-minute travel.

Most modern coaches offer Wi-Fi, USB charging and reclining seats. Overnight services exist on longer corridors and can save a hotel night.

Porto to Florence by flight

Flights between Porto and Florence take around 2h in the air, but plan on roughly 4h 42m door-to-door once you add airport transfers, check-in and security.

Airlines on this route include Ryanair, easyJet, TAP Air Portugal, ITA Airways.

Typical fare range is €101–318. Low-cost carriers offer the cheapest base fares but charge separately for bags and seat selection.

Given the 1653 km distance, flying is the practical choice for most travellers on this route.

Climate footprint: approximately 258 kg CO₂ per passenger for this flight.

Porto to Florence by car

The driving distance from Porto to Florence is approximately 1900 km. At motorway speeds, plan on around 18h 22m of driving plus stops.

Fuel-only running cost is in the €198–364 range for a typical car. Toll roads may apply, especially in France, Italy, Spain, Austria and Switzerland — budget extra accordingly.

Crossing the Portugal–Italy border by car is straightforward within the Schengen Area; check current rules with the operator or border authority if either country is outside it.

Climate footprint: approximately 281 kg CO₂ per passenger assuming 1.5 occupants per car.
